There are still some Cyber Security Professionals who claim that the Cyber Security Talent Crisis is a myth. Host George Rettas reviews the facts and gives his frank assessment of the Talent Crisis that is introducing so much more risk into cyber security programs around the world. Is everyone wrong? Rettas also reports on the situation around the Uber hack and their decision to pay the hackers $100K to not use all the information that they stole from Uber. Where did that $100K payment go? Rettas also gives an update on the Qatar Crisis and decision by the United States Attorneys Office of the Southern District of New York to announce an indictment against an Iranian National for the very public hack of HBO.
